Work Description(Alternative Delivery) The CMGC project will upgrade SR 58 from 2- to 4-lanes in San Bernardino County from the Kern County line to 7.5 miles east of US-395.
Location DescriptionSR-58 / 395 Kramer Junction project. In San Bernardino County from the Kern County line to 7.5 miles east of US-395.
